2005 Mercedes-Benz G vs. 2005 Opel Astra
To start off, both 2005 Mercedes-Benz G and 2005 Opel Astra were released in the same year (2005).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 4,966 cc (8 cylinders), 2005 Mercedes-Benz G is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Mercedes-Benz G (292 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 203 more horse power than 2005 Opel Astra. (89 HP @ 5600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 Mercedes-Benz G should accelerate faster than 2005 Opel Astra.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Mercedes-Benz G weights approximately 1220 kg more than 2005 Opel Astra.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2005 Mercedes-Benz G is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2005 Opel Astra.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Mercedes-Benz G will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 Mercedes-Benz G (456 Nm @ 2800 RPM) has 331 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Opel Astra. (125 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2005 Mercedes-Benz G will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Opel Astra. 2005 Mercedes-Benz G has automatic transmission and 2005 Opel Astra has manual transmission. 2005 Opel Astra will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2005 Mercedes-Benz G will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2005 Mercedes-Benz G | 2005 Opel Astra | |
Make | Mercedes-Benz | Opel |
Model | G | Astra |
Year Released | 2005 | 2005 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4966 cc | 1362 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 3 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 292 HP | 89 HP |
Engine RPM | 5500 RPM | 5600 RPM |
Torque | 456 Nm | 125 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2800 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 97.1 mm | 73.4 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 84 mm | 80.6 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.0:1 | 10.5: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line - Premium |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 9.7 seconds | 13.7 seconds |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 3 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 2375 kg | 1155 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4230 mm | 4260 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1770 mm | 1760 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1940 mm | 1470 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2410 mm | 2710 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 16.7 L/100km | 6.3 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 96 L | 52 L |
